The Central Supply Tech is responsible for task-based Central Supply activities.
Responsibilities- The Central Supply Tech is responsible for all activities assigned during their shift, to include: quality and accuracy of work produced and reports at the end of the shift as to work performed and the status of the department.
- Complies with all department specific policies and procedures.
- Identifies and reports supply, equipment, and procedure problems to the Central Supply Supervisor or Manager.
Qualifications - External
EducationPreferred: High School Graduate or equivalent
ExperienceRequired: 1 year in Central Supply.
CertificationsRequired: BLS
